多任务处理是现代操作系统的重要特性,它允许多个进程并发运行,从而提高系统的效率和响应速度。随着计算需求的不断增加,特别是在云计算和大数据时代,操作系统的多任务处理机制变得愈发复杂但也愈发重要。

在多任务处理的背景下,无论是Windows、Linux,还是macOS,各大操作系统在架构上有着显著的差异。Windows通常采用抢占式多任务处理,通过时间片轮转的方式,让多个软件相互竞争CPU的使用权。Linux则在内核级别提供高度的可定制性,使得开发者可以根据需要调整多任务的调度策略。而macOS则全面依赖于其Unix基础结构,实施精确的任务调度和资源管理,使得多任务处理不仅高效而且极具稳定性。
市场趋势方面,近年来的性能评测显示,多核处理器的普及大大提升了多任务处理的能力。相较于单核处理器,多核架构可以同时处理更多的线程,这对业界对于高性能计算和数据并行处理的需求起到了积极的推动作用。在云计算环境中,虚拟化技术的应用进一步提升了系统资源的利用率,使得单一硬件上可以同时运行多个操作系统实例,从而实现更高的业务灵活性。
对于普通用户而言,建立一台高性能的多任务处理系统并不复杂。DIY组装技巧可以显著提高家庭或办公电脑的性能。例如,选择一款支持超线程技术的CPU,可以在多任务环境下获得更好的处理效率。增加内存容量和更换SSD固态硬盘也是提升系统性能的有效手段,这将减少数据读写的延迟,提高程序启动和运行的响应速度。
性能优化方面,合理配置操作系统的启动项目、定期清理无用程序、更新驱动程序等措施,都有助于提升多任务处理的表现。用户还可以利用任务管理器监控运行的进程,明确哪些程序消耗过多资源,进而进行调整。这些细节的优化,可以有效减少系统的负担,确保在高负载情况下仍然能从容应对。
在不断发展变化的计算环境下,操作系统的多任务处理能力已成为用户选择平台的重要考量因素。理解并掌握这一机制,将为开发者和用户的使用体验带来积极影响。
常见问题解答 (FAQ)
1. 什么是多任务处理?
多任务处理是操作系统允许多个进程同时运行的能力,通过调度算法来管理资源分配。
2. 多核处理器如何提升多任务能力?
多核处理器可以同时处理多个线程,提高系统的并发处理能力,减少整体处理时间。
3. 有哪些方法可以优化多任务处理性能?
常见方法包括增加内存、使用SSD、优化启动项、定期清理系统等。
4. 如何选择适合多任务处理的CPU?
选择支持超线程技术的CPU,并根据实际使用需求选择合适的核心数。
5. 虚拟化技术在多任务处理中的作用是什么?
虚拟化技术允许在同一硬件上运行多个操作系统实例,提高资源利用率和灵活性。
